Identify Leak Source: Inspect shower pan for cracks, gaps, or water damage to locate the leak
A leaking shower pan can lead to water damage, mold growth, and structural issues if left unaddressed. Before diving into the replacement process, pinpointing the exact source of the leak is critical. Start by thoroughly inspecting the shower pan for visible signs of damage, such as cracks, gaps, or areas of water accumulation. Use a bright flashlight to illuminate hard-to-see corners and edges, as even small fissures can be the culprit. If the pan is covered by tiles or a liner, carefully remove these materials to expose the surface for a detailed examination.
Analyzing the type of damage can provide clues about the underlying cause. Hairline cracks, for instance, often result from age-related wear or shifting in the foundation, while larger gaps may stem from improper installation or heavy impact. Water stains or discoloration on the pan’s surface indicate prolonged exposure to moisture, suggesting a slow leak. For a more precise assessment, dry the shower area completely and run water in the shower for 15–20 minutes, then inspect again. This method helps isolate active leaks from residual moisture.
Instructively, begin your inspection at the drain, as this is a common trouble spot. Check for loose connections or gaps between the drain assembly and the pan. If the drain appears intact, move outward, examining the pan’s edges where it meets the wall. Gaps in the caulking or sealant here can allow water to seep underneath. For tiled shower pans, pay attention to grout lines, as missing or cracked grout can create pathways for water to penetrate the substrate.
Persuasively, investing time in this step can save you from unnecessary repairs or replacements. Misidentifying the leak source might lead to fixing the wrong area, only for the problem to persist. For example, if you assume the leak is due to a cracked tile but the actual issue is a faulty drain seal, replacing the tile will not resolve the leak. A systematic inspection ensures you address the root cause, preventing recurring issues and additional costs.
Comparatively, while some leaks are obvious—like water pooling on the bathroom floor—others are subtle, such as dampness in adjacent walls or ceilings. If visual inspection alone doesn’t reveal the source, consider using a moisture meter to detect hidden water damage. This tool can identify damp areas behind walls or under flooring, guiding you to the leak’s origin. Pairing this technology with a hands-on inspection maximizes accuracy, ensuring no potential source is overlooked.

Remove Old Shower Pan: Disconnect drain, cut caulk, and carefully lift out the damaged pan
The first step in replacing a leaking shower pan is to remove the old one, a task that requires precision and care to avoid damaging surrounding tiles or plumbing. Begin by disconnecting the drain, a critical step that often involves unscrewing the drain strainer or removing the drain cover. Use a screwdriver or a drain key, depending on the type of drain assembly, and work gently to avoid stripping any screws. Once the drain is disconnected, you’ll have access to the underside of the shower pan, which is essential for the next steps.
Next, focus on the caulk that seals the shower pan to the walls and floor. This caulk is typically silicone-based and can be stubborn to remove. Use a utility knife or a caulk removal tool to carefully cut through the caulk line, taking care not to scratch tiles or damage the surrounding area. Work methodically around the entire perimeter of the shower pan, ensuring all caulk is severed. For particularly tough caulk, a chemical caulk remover can be applied, but follow the manufacturer’s instructions and ensure proper ventilation.
With the drain disconnected and the caulk cut, it’s time to lift out the old shower pan. This step requires caution, as the pan may be heavy and awkward to handle, especially if it’s made of fiberglass or tile. Enlist a helper if possible to avoid injury or damage to the shower enclosure. Start by gently prying the pan away from the walls and floor using a pry bar or flathead screwdriver, working slowly to avoid cracking the pan or disturbing the subfloor. Once the pan is loose, lift it out carefully, being mindful of any remaining debris or adhesive that may need to be scraped away later.
Removing the old shower pan is a delicate balance of force and finesse. While it’s tempting to rush, patience ensures that the surrounding area remains intact, simplifying the installation of the new pan. Always inspect the subfloor and walls after removal for signs of water damage or mold, addressing any issues before proceeding. By following these steps—disconnecting the drain, cutting the caulk, and carefully lifting out the pan—you’ll create a clean slate for the new shower pan, setting the stage for a leak-free installation.

Prepare Subfloor: Clean, repair, and level the subfloor to ensure proper installation of the new pan
A compromised subfloor can turn your new shower pan into a short-term solution, leading to recurring leaks and structural damage. Before installing the replacement, meticulously prepare the subfloor to ensure longevity and performance. Start by clearing the area of debris, old adhesive, and any remnants of the previous pan. Use a stiff brush and a vacuum to remove loose particles, then wipe down the surface with a damp cloth to eliminate dust and grime. For stubborn residue, apply a suitable adhesive remover, following the manufacturer’s instructions for application time and safety precautions.
Once clean, inspect the subfloor for damage. Common issues include rot, cracks, or unevenness, particularly in older homes or areas exposed to prolonged moisture. For minor cracks, fill them with a waterproof patching compound, such as hydraulic cement or epoxy-based filler, ensuring the product is rated for wet environments. If the subfloor is wooden and shows signs of rot, cut out the damaged sections and replace them with pressure-treated plywood. Secure the new pieces with corrosion-resistant screws, ensuring they are flush with the existing surface.
Leveling the subfloor is critical to prevent water pooling and ensure the new pan sits correctly. Use a long straightedge or level to identify low spots, then apply a self-leveling underlayment compound to these areas. Follow the product instructions for mixing ratios and application thickness, typically 1/8 to 1/4 inch. Allow the compound to cure fully, which can take 24 hours or more depending on humidity and temperature. For precision, recheck the level after curing and apply additional compound if necessary.
While preparing the subfloor, consider adding a waterproof membrane for extra protection. Products like liquid waterproofing or sheet membranes (e.g., PVC or CPE) create a barrier against moisture penetration. Apply liquid membranes with a roller or brush in thin, even coats, allowing each layer to dry before adding the next. For sheet membranes, cut the material to fit the subfloor, overlapping seams by at least 3 inches and sealing them with compatible tape or adhesive. This step, though optional, significantly reduces the risk of future leaks.
Proper subfloor preparation is not just a preliminary step—it’s the foundation of a successful shower pan replacement. Skipping or rushing this phase can lead to costly repairs down the line. By cleaning thoroughly, repairing damage, ensuring a level surface, and adding waterproofing, you create a stable, durable base for the new pan. This meticulous approach not only prevents leaks but also extends the life of your shower system, making it a worthwhile investment of time and effort.

Install New Pan: Position the new pan, connect the drain, and secure it in place
Positioning the new shower pan is a critical step that demands precision. Start by placing the pan in the shower stall, ensuring it aligns perfectly with the existing drain hole. Use a level to confirm the pan is flat and even, as any tilt can lead to water pooling or improper drainage. If the pan sits on a mortar bed, verify that the bed is level and free of debris. For pre-fabricated pans, double-check that the manufacturer’s markings for the drain location match your shower’s setup. A misaligned pan not only compromises functionality but can also void warranties or lead to future leaks.
Connecting the drain is where attention to detail becomes paramount. Begin by applying a bead of silicone caulk or plumber’s putty around the underside of the drain flange to create a watertight seal. Insert the drain assembly into the pan’s drain hole, ensuring it fits snugly. Tighten the drain from below using a screwdriver or wrench, but avoid over-tightening, as this can crack the pan. If your shower uses a clamping ring, secure it evenly to hold the drain in place. Test the connection by pouring water into the pan and checking for leaks beneath the drain. If leaks occur, disassemble and reapply sealant before reconnecting.
Securing the new pan in place is the final step to ensure stability and longevity. For pans resting on a mortar bed, press firmly to embed it into the mortar, then allow the mortar to cure for at least 24 hours. If using a pre-fabricated pan, anchor it to the wall studs or floor joists with screws and brackets as per the manufacturer’s instructions. Apply a generous bead of silicone caulk around the pan’s perimeter where it meets the walls and floor to prevent water infiltration. Wipe away excess caulk with a damp cloth for a clean finish. Avoid using the shower for 48 hours to allow the caulk to fully cure, ensuring a durable seal.
A comparative analysis of installation methods reveals that pre-fabricated pans are often quicker to install but require precise alignment, while mortar beds offer greater customization but demand more skill and drying time. Regardless of the method, the key takeaway is that each step—positioning, connecting the drain, and securing—must be executed with care to prevent future leaks. Skipping any of these steps or rushing the process can lead to costly repairs down the line. By following these specific instructions, you can ensure a watertight, long-lasting shower pan installation.

Seal and Test: Apply silicone caulk around edges, let it dry, and test for leaks
Silicone caulk is the unsung hero of shower pan replacement, bridging the gap between new and old surfaces to prevent future leaks. Its flexibility and water resistance make it ideal for sealing the edges where the pan meets the walls and floor. However, its effectiveness hinges on proper application and patience during the drying process. Rushing this step can lead to incomplete seals, undermining the entire repair.
Begin by cleaning the edges thoroughly, removing any debris, old caulk, or residue. Use a utility knife or caulk removal tool to ensure a smooth surface. Once clean, apply a bead of silicone caulk along the edges, maintaining a consistent thickness. A caulking gun with a smooth pressure application ensures even distribution. For precision, use painter’s tape to mask off the edges, creating clean lines and preventing excess caulk from spreading. Allow the caulk to dry according to the manufacturer’s instructions, typically 24 hours, though humidity and temperature can affect curing time.
Testing for leaks is a critical step often overlooked. After the caulk has fully dried, run water into the shower pan for at least 15 minutes, simulating regular use. Inspect the edges and surrounding areas for any signs of moisture. If leaks appear, identify the weak points, remove the caulk, and reapply. This iterative process ensures a watertight seal, saving you from future headaches and costly repairs.
Comparatively, while other sealants like latex caulk or adhesive tapes exist, silicone caulk stands out for its durability and mold resistance in wet environments. Its ability to expand and contract with temperature changes makes it superior for long-term use. However, it requires more precision during application, emphasizing the need for practice or professional guidance if unsure.
In conclusion, sealing and testing with silicone caulk is a meticulous yet essential step in replacing a leaking shower pan. It demands attention to detail, patience, and a methodical approach. By following these guidelines, you ensure a robust seal that protects your bathroom from water damage, extending the life of your new shower pan.
